Default I found a pill and i can't find out what it is

I found a pill in my little sister's room and i need to find out what it is. I tried to find out what it is but so far I've had no luck at all. Its a round white pill that has (wpi 858) in red. If someone could help me find out what it is I would be happy.

It's Bupropion, the generic form of Wellbutrin. It's like Zyban, which helps people quit smoking, but is also used as an anti-depressant.
